Transaction 950140446172e3533807e9d92474ab0c85d2528a9fb4d1011af7aa95e3812e49

block
0358a8343164b9e373d03cefc964745eff6ac12370fb5c94da69f49a23fac3f5

2 Inputs

6 Outputs